Built In Shelving Service in Durham, NC
Built-in shelving services provide homeowners with customized storage solutions that maximize space and enhance the functionality of various rooms. These projects typically include installing shelves within walls in areas such as living rooms, bedrooms, home offices, and closets. Property owners often seek built-in shelving to improve organization, create a seamless aesthetic, or make better use of underutilized spaces.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to consider the specific dimensions, style preferences, and the purpose of the shelves to ensure the design aligns with the overall interior.
Property owners should also evaluate the structural aspects of the installation site, such as wall material and load-bearing capacity, to determine the most suitable shelving options. Clarifying whether the shelves will be used for decorative displays, storage, or a combination of both can influence the design and materials selected. Understanding these details ahead of time helps ensure the finished project meets expectations and integrates smoothly into the existing space.
